GARLIC - Exports of Powder totaled 1.8 million pounds for the first three months of 2001, up 68% when compared to the same period of time in 2000. U.S. exports to Australia totaled 329,980 pounds, a substantial increase from the 98,064 pounds shipped last year.
U.S. exports to Mexico totaled 225,233 pounds compared to only 4,367 pounds in 2000 and had a f.a.s. value of $126,154 or 56 cents per pound, according The Food Institute's Analysis of Bureau of Census data.
Shipments to Spain, typically a large market for U.S. Garlic Powder, were down 52% to 67,444 pounds.
